Effective pills for high blood pressure: An Overview of the most important groups of Drugs High blood pressure, known medically as hypertension, is a major health risk and is a main factor for cardiovascular diseases such as heart attack, stroke, and kidney damage. The reduction in blood pressure by drug therapy can reduce the risk of these complications significantly. Goals of therapy The goal of blood pressure therapy is to keep the blood pressure in the long term under 140/90 mmHg (millimeters of Mercury), in patients with Diabetes or kidney disease, even under 130/80 mmHg. This is usually achieved by a combination of lifestyle changes (healthy diet, exercise, weight reduction, avoiding Smoking and excessive alcohol consumption) and medications. Important groups of Drugs for high blood pressure There are different classes of blood pressure core, the work in different ways. The most important are: ACE inhibitors (Angiotensin‑converting enzyme inhibitors): Mechanism of action: Inhibit the enzyme ACE, the formation of the Pressor substance Angiotensin II is responsible. As a result, the vasoconstriction is prevented, and the blood pressure is lowered. Examples: Ramipril, Enalapril, Lisinopril. Side effects: cough, cardiovascular reactions (e.g. dizziness), increased levels of potassium. AT1‑receptor blockers (Sartans): Mechanism of action: Blocking the effect of Angiotensin II to its receptors, which also leads to a relaxation of the blood vessels. Examples: Losartan, Valsartan, Candesartan. Side effects: Similar to ACE inhibitors, but the cough occurs less frequently. Calcium antagonists: Mechanism of action: Prevent the vessels of the influx of calcium ions into the smooth muscles of the blood, which leads to vasodilatation and, consequently, to a reduction in blood pressure. Examples: Amlodipine, Nifedipine, Diltiazem. Side effects: swelling of the legs (Edema), redness of the face, tachycardia. Diuretics (diuretics): Mechanism of action: Result in increased excretion of water and salt through the kidneys, reducing the blood volume and thus blood pressure decreases. Examples: hydrochlorothiazide, indapamide, furosemide (in severe cases). Side effects: loss of Electrolyte (e.g., potassium), thirst, increased blood sugar and uric acid levels. Beta-blockers: Mechanism of action: Dampen the effects of the stress hormone adrenaline on the heart. The heart beats slower and weaker, causing the blood pressure drops. Examples: Metoprolol, Bisoprolol, Carvedilol. Side effects: fatigue, coldness of the limbs, impaired blood sugar control. Combination therapy and individual adjustment Often the gift of a single specimen is not sufficient to reach the goal. In such cases, two or more drugs from different drug groups are combined. This increases the effectiveness and minimize the side effects, since lower doses can be used. The therapy must always be individually adjusted. The following factors play a role: The age of the patient, The presence of concomitant diseases (Diabetes, kidney disease, congestive heart failure), possible side effects and interactions with other drugs, personal preferences of the patient. Conclusion The pharmacotherapy of hypertension is based on a broad Foundation of effective groups of Drugs. The proper selection and combination of these substances, based on individual patient characteristics, allows for the effective control of blood pressure and contributes significantly to the prevention of life-threatening complications. Close coordination between the physician and the Patient, is of crucial importance.

Diseases of the circulatory system of the people The cardiovascular System plays a Central role in the maintenance of homeostasis in the human body. It embraces the heart as a Central pumping mechanism, as well as the network of blood vessels — arteries, veins and capillaries — that ensure the continuous Transport of oxygen, nutrients, hormones and waste products. Diseases of this system are one of the leading causes of death worldwide and represent a major public health Problem. Among the most common diseases of the cardiovascular system: Coronary heart disease (CHD): it is caused by a narrowing of the coronary arteries due to atherosclerosis, which leads to reduced blood flow to the heart muscle. Symptoms may include Angina pectoris (chest pain), shortness of breath, and in severe cases a myocardial infarction. Hypertension (high blood pressure) is Defined as a permanently elevated blood pressure (≥140/90 mmHg), can hypertension overload the heart and the risk for stroke, heart attack, and kidney damage increase significantly. Heart failure: In this disease, the ability of the heart to pump blood efficiently is affected. Consequences are often Edema (water retention), shortness of breath and fatigue. Arrhythmias: deviations from the normal heart rhythm, such as atrial fibrillation or ventricular fibrillation, can lead to insufficient blood circulation and an increased risk of stroke. Atherosclerosis is A systemic process in which Plaques (deposits of cholesterol, fat and other substances) in the blood vessel walls and form. This, the blood vessels constrict or block and is the basis of many cardiovascular diseases. Risk factors for cardiovascular disease in modifiable and non-modifiable groups: Modifiable factors: Smoking, unhealthy diet, physical inactivity, Overweight/obesity, Diabetes mellitus, hyperlipidemia, and chronic Stress. Non-modifiable factors: Genetic predisposition, age and gender (men are suspended until menopause age, a higher risk). Diagnostic methods for the detection of cardiovascular disease include: Electrocardiogram (ECG) Echocardiography Stress tests Coronary angiography Blood tests (e.g., Troponin measurement in the case of suspected infarction) Therapeutic approaches vary depending on the disease and include drug therapy (e.g., beta-blockers, ACE inhibitors, statins), is a lifestyle‑related measures and surgical interventions (e.g., Bypass surgery or Stent Implantation). Prevention remains the most effective way to reduce the incidence and mortality of diseases of the cardiovascular system. A healthy way of life, regular medical examinations, and the early identification of risk factors are of crucial importance.
